ABSTRACT:
A pulling tool and method for pulling an operating tool from a downhole location in a wellbore in which an elongated tubular housing assembly is connectable to a section of reeled tubing and defines a longitudinal bore through which fluid passes from said reeled tubing. A passage extends through the housing assembly and communicates with the longitudinal bore of the housing assembly for discharging the fluid against the wall of the wellbore and the fishing neck of the operating tool to clean same. A latching assembly is disposed on the housing assembly for latching to the fishing neck of the operating tool as the housing assembly is inserted into the fishing neck to enable the fishing neck and the operating tool to be pulled from the wellbore. In the event the operating tool cannot be pulled from the wellbore, the flow of fluid through the passage of the housing assembly can be blocked to enable the fluid pressure to build up in the bore of the housing assembly, in which case the housing assembly operates to release the fishing neck to enable the housing assembly to be removed from the wellbore.
